Almost 100 people killed in Bangladesh protests as nationwide curfew imposed

At least 95 people have been killed and hundreds more injured in clashes between police and tens of thousands of anti-government protesters in Bangladesh, according to reports.

Student leaders have declared a campaign of civil disobedience demanding that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ina quit.
